Description

Stability and compatibility tests assess both the stability of the finished product and its interaction with the packaging. They examine chemical compatibility, material permeability, and potential migration between the contents and the packaging. Conducted in accordance with ICH guidelines or ISO standards, these tests are essential for validating primary packaging for cosmetic, nutraceutical, or food products.

These tests are conducted under real or accelerated conditions to simulate the effects of time, temperature, humidity, and light on the product/packaging assembly. They allow for the detection of potential interactions that could alter the product's quality, efficacy, or safety: color changes, degradation of active ingredients, and absorption or release of compounds by the packaging. Their implementation is particularly recommended when selecting a new material, changing suppliers, or launching a product in new markets.
